#f9a860 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f9a860 is composed of 97.6% red, 65.9%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.5% magenta, 61.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 28.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 67.6%. #f9a860 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#f35100.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#f9a860

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0500 is the darkest color, while #fffb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f9a860

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adacac is the less saturated color, while #f9a860 is the most saturated one.
